Triceps dips

The triceps are actually a large three headed skeletal muscles that are found in the humans. The triceps run along in the back of each of the upper part of the arms. Tai Chi

Tai chi is one of the many activities that can be done while watching TV. In Mandarin, Tai Chi or Tai Chi Chuan refers to “supreme fighting”. It is mainly a form of martial arts originated in China around the 16th century. During the 1970s, it was introduced in the United States, and has been growing in popularity ever since.

Push ups

Push ups also known as press ups is one of the most common form of free hand exercises. It is basically a strength training exercise that is performed in a prone position, where the performer while lying in the horizontal and face down, raising and lowering the body using the arms.
